Must Definition & Meaning

must
adjective
  1. highly recommended; "a book that is must reading"
noun
  1. a necessary or essential thing; "seat belts are an absolute must"
  2. grape juice before or during fermentation
  3. the quality of smelling or tasting old or stale or mouldy
